For this week's sketch challenge, though I was a bit loose with my design! I didn't need a Valentine's card, and I couldn't find my banner dies, so this is what I ended up with! If you squint your eyes you'll kinda see Diane's general layout ;)
I've used Hadley and Kitty give Bradley a big hug from Eat Cake Graphics, a Paper Smooches heart and MFT alpha set.
Coloured with watercolour pencils, and I also watercoloured the background and a few splatters for good measure.
I also added some clear gloss and sparkle to the critters' collars and to the stripe in the heart.
